Hi readers!!! This week I will be reviewing a book called THE MOM HUNT by Gwenyth Rees.

This week I will be reviewing a book named THE MOM HUNT. This book is about a girl who tries to  find her dad the perfect match. She asks her au pair Juliette about and suddenly she has a great idea. She sees an ad for the lonely hearts matchmaker in the paper.

My favorite part was when they saw THE SOUND OF MUSIC and the girl thinks her au pair was perfect for her dad.

There were no illustrations in this book but the extensive vocabulary helped me fell what the character was feeling.

I would recommend this book to people who like to read drama.
